Stop us if you've heard this one before ... former WWE diva Tammy Sytch was just arrested in Connecticut ... her 5th arrest in 4 weeks.

Law enforcement tells us ... Tammy -- who wrestled under the name Sunny -- was popped in Branford this afternoon ... hours after she was released from jail on Arrest #4 .

This time, Tammy was busted for 3rd degree burglary and 3 counts of violating a protective order.

We broke the story, Sytch was also arrested yesterday for violating a protective order when she was found passed out in the home of her ex-BF.

Tammy had also been arrested 3 times in 3 days back in September under similar circumstances.

Tammy is currently being held without bond and is expected to see a judge in the morning ... who will probably release her so she can get arrested again.

Wrestlezone reported Tuesday that former WWE Diva Tammy "Sunny" Sytch had been arrested for the fifth time in four weeks, on a count of burglary in the third degree, and violating a restraining order that dates back to her earlier arrests in September.

Sunny appeared before a judge Wednesday morning, and her bail was set at a $100,000 cash bond. As noted by NHRegister.com, a cash bond must be paid in full prior to a release. An official WWE spokesman issued the following statement:

“Unfortunately, Ms. Sytch continues to make poor personal choices. WWE will continue to provide assistance should she want to take advantage of it."
